Explicação detalhada da tecnologia CDN: como acelerar um website e melhorar a experiência do utilizador a nível global

Leitura de 2 minutos
2026-03-28
2,038
Eu recebo uma comissão quando você faz compras através dos links abaixo, sem custo adicional para você.

Na era digital, a velocidade dos websites está diretamente relacionada à experiência do usuário, à taxa de conversão e até mesmo à classificação nos mecanismos de busca. Quando usuários acessam o seu site de diferentes partes do mundo, como garantir que todos recebam um serviço rápido e estável? É aí que a tecnologia de rede de distribuição de conteúdo (Content Delivery Network – CDN) se destaca. Por meio de um conjunto de soluções inteligentes, o conteúdo do site é armazenado em nós de servidores distribuídos por todo o mundo, permitindo que os usuários obtenham os dados a partir do nó mais próximo geograficamente. Isso reduz significativamente o atraso na conexão e a carga de tráfego da internet.

Como as CDNs funcionam em sua essência

O CDN (Content Delivery Network) não é um serviço único, mas sim uma rede inteligente composta por várias partes que trabalham em conjunto. O seu objetivo principal é “entregar” o conteúdo para os usuários de forma mais rápida e eficiente.

Cache e distribuição de conteúdo

O servidor de origem é o local onde o conteúdo realmente reside. Quando você configura o serviço CDN pela primeira vez, ele extrai os recursos estáticos do seu servidor de origem, como imagens, arquivos CSS, arquivos JavaScript e streams de vídeo. Esses recursos são armazenados em nós de borda do CDN distribuídos por todo o mundo.

Leitura recomendada Desvendando a tecnologia CDN: Como acelerar o acesso a sites em todo o mundo e melhorar a experiência do usuário

Quando um usuário envia uma solicitação, o sistema de agendamento inteligente do CDN começa a funcionar. Ele calcula o nó de borda mais adequado com base na localização geográfica do usuário, nas condições da rede e na carga dos nós, e redireciona a solicitação para esse nó. Se o conteúdo da solicitação já estiver armazenado em cache no nó, ele é retornado diretamente ao usuário; esse processo é normalmente chamado de “acerto de cache”. Caso o conteúdo não esteja em cache, o nó solicita o conteúdo da origem, armazena-o em cache e o fornece ao usuário, atendendo também a solicitações subsequentes do mesmo tipo.

\nCDN do bunny.net
\nCDN do bunny.net
Os pagamentos mensais começam em apenas US$ 1, com taxas claras e não ocultas. Os recursos incluem cache permanente, monitoramento em tempo real, proteção contra DDoS e certificados SSL gratuitos, otimizados para streaming de vídeo, além de um modelo de faturamento flexível por uso.
Não é necessário cartão de crédito, teste gratuito de 14 dias
Visite a CDN do bunny.net →
Cloudways Cloudflare Enterprise
Cloudways Cloudflare Enterprise
O plano de preços Enterprise CDN/WAF da Cloudflare é de US$ 4,99/mês por domínio para até 5 domínios, incluindo 100 GB de tráfego, e US$ 0,02/GB para qualquer valor além desse.
100 GB de tráfego gratuito por domínio
Acesso ao Cloudflare Enterprise da Cloudways →

Balanceamento de carga e redundância

O CDN (Content Delivery Network) alcança um equilíbrio de carga natural devido à sua ampla distribuição de nós. Isso evita o congestionamento e o risco de falhas em um único ponto, que ocorreriam se todo o tráfego fosse direcionado para um único servidor de origem. Mesmo que um nó falhe, o sistema de agendamento consegue redirecionar as solicitações dos usuários para outros nós funcionais, garantindo a alta disponibilidade do serviço e a continuidade das operações.

Quais são os principais benefícios que o CDN (Content Delivery Network) pode trazer para um site?

As vantagens da implementação de um CDN (Content Delivery Network) são múltiplas e afetam diretamente os indicadores técnicos e os resultados comerciais.

Aumentar drasticamente a velocidade de carregamento do seu site

Este é o benefício mais direto e significativo do CDN (Content Delivery Network). Ao entregar o conteúdo a partir de nós de borda (edge nodes), a distância que os dados precisam percorrer para serem transmitidos é significativamente reduzida, o que diminui o atraso na comunicação. Isso significa que as páginas da web abrem mais rapidamente, e imagens e vídeos são carregados com mais velocidade. Para sites de comércio eletrônico, cada segundo a mais de velocidade pode levar a uma taxa de conversão mais alta; para meios de comunicação, a velocidade significa que as informações são disponibilizadas mais rapidamente.

Reduzir eficazmente os custos de largura de banda da estação de origem.

Como a maioria dos pedidos dos usuários é atendida pelos nós de borda, apenas os pedidos não armazenados em cache ou o conteúdo dinâmico são enviados de volta para o servidor de origem. Isso geralmente reduz o tráfego de largura de banda de saída do servidor de origem em 701 TB/s, ou até mais. Para serviços cobrados com base na largura de banda, isso se traduz em uma economia significativa de custos.

Leitura recomendada Análise detalhada: como as CDNs aceleram seu site e mantêm sua rede segura

Melhorar a segurança e a capacidade de resistência a ataques dos websites

Os serviços de CDN (Content Delivery Network) modernos geralmente integram funcionalidades de segurança de alto nível. Eles oferecem proteção contra ataques de negação de serviço distribuída, identificando e bloqueando tráfego malicioso através de sua vasta capacidade de rede e de centros de filtragem inteligentes, permitindo que apenas o tráfego legítimo chegue ao site fonte. Além disso, ao ocultar o endereço IP real do site fonte, o CDN também adiciona uma camada adicional de proteção para o site.

Melhorar a estabilidade e a disponibilidade do acesso em todo o mundo.

Para sites que possuem usuários internacionais, o CDN (Content Delivery Network) é a pedra angular para garantir uma experiência de acesso de alta qualidade em todo o mundo. Ele assegura que os usuários obtenham velocidades de conexão relativamente consistentes e confiáveis, independentemente de onde estejam localizados, evitando lentidões ou interrupções no acesso devido a congestionamentos de rede entre países ou problemas com os operadores de serviços de comunicação. Isso, por sua vez, melhora a imagem global do serviço oferecido pela marca.

Como escolher o serviço de CDN certo para o seu site

Diante de tantos fornecedores de CDN (Content Delivery Networks), tomar uma decisão sábia requer considerar vários fatores em diferentes dimensões.

Avaliação do alcance de cobertura e do desempenho dos nós

Primeiramente, analise a distribuição global dos nodes do provedor de serviços, especialmente nas regiões onde seus usuários-alvo se encontram. A qualidade e o número de nodes também são muito importantes. Você pode utilizar ferramentas de monitoramento de terceiros ou realizar testes por conta própria para avaliar a velocidade de resposta e a estabilidade de diferentes CDNs em áreas-chave. Um CDN que se destaca no Norte Americano pode não ser tão bom na Ásia.

Análise das funcionalidades e integração com serviços externos

A aceleração de conteúdo estático básico é padrão. No entanto, você pode precisar de funcionalidades mais avançadas, como:
Aceleração de conteúdo dinâmico: otimização de roteamento para conteúdo que não pode ser armazenado em cache, como chamadas de API e páginas personalizadas.
Vídeo a pedido e transmissão em direto: otimização de streaming especializada, conversão de formatos e suporte a DRM.
Firewall de aplicações web e proteção contra DDoS: níveis de capacidade de proteção de segurança integrados.
Análise de registos em tempo real e monitorização em tempo real: conveniência para operações e manutenção, bem como para resolução de problemas.
A dificuldade de integração com os seus serviços cloud ou de armazenamento existentes.

Compreender os modelos de cobrança e os custos

O CDN (Content Delivery Network) geralmente é cobrado com base no volume de tráfego de banda larga ou no número de solicitações. É necessário estimar os custos de acordo com o padrão de tráfego e o tamanho do seu site, e comparar as faixas de preços oferecidas pelos diferentes provedores de serviços. Atente também a detalhes como a possibilidade de cobranças adicionais por picos de tráfego de banda larga ou se as solicitações HTTPS têm um custo extra. Um controle de custos claro é essencial para a operação de longo prazo.

Leitura recomendada Acelerando o acesso aos websites: uma análise aprofundada do funcionamento, das vantagens e das melhores práticas do CDN

Melhores práticas de configuração e otimização de CDN

A conexão bem-sucedida ao CDN é apenas o primeiro passo; uma configuração adequada é necessária para liberar todo o seu potencial.

Ajustes detalhados da política de cache

Nem todo o conteúdo é adequado para ser armazenado em cache por um longo período de tempo. Você precisa definir prazos de validade diferentes para cada tipo de conteúdo.
Para recursos estáticos que quase nunca são alterados (como JS/CSS versionados e imagens de logotipo), você pode definir um tempo de cache longo, de vários meses a um ano, e forçar os usuários a obter uma nova versão sempre que o arquivo for atualizado, alterando o nome do arquivo ou os parâmetros da consulta.
Para conteúdo que possa ser atualizado (como páginas de artigos de notícias), pode-se definir um tempo de cache mais curto ou combinar com a tecnologia “edge side”, que remove automaticamente o cache antigo da CDN quando o conteúdo é alterado.
Para conteúdo dinâmico altamente personalizado (como o carrinho de compras do utilizador), é geralmente configurado para não ser armazenado em cache ou apenas para ser armazenado em cache por um período muito curto.

Ativar protocolos modernos como HTTPS e HTTP/2

Assegure-se de que a configuração do seu CDN suporte e exija o uso de HTTPS para garantir a segurança da transmissão de dados e a privacidade dos usuários. Além disso, ativar o HTTP/2 ou protocolos mais avançados pode melhorar significativamente a eficiência da transmissão, possibilitando o uso de múltiplos canais de comunicação e a compressão dos dados enviados, o que melhora ainda mais o desempenho de carregamento das páginas.

Monitorização contínua e análise de desempenho.

Não basta “configurar e esquecer”. Utilize o console do fornecedor de CDN e ferramentas de monitoramento de desempenho de terceiros (como Lighthouse, WebPageTest) para acompanhar continuamente os indicadores de desempenho do site em todo o mundo. Preste atenção à taxa de acertos do cache, ao tempo necessário para carregar o primeiro byte do conteúdo, aos tempos de carregamento em diferentes regiões, entre outros dados. Com base nos resultados da análise de dados, ajuste continuamente a estratégia de cache e as configurações de agendamento dos servidores, a fim de responder às mudanças no negócio e ao crescimento do número de usuários.

resumos

A tecnologia CDN (Content Delivery Network) tornou-se uma infraestrutura essencial na arquitetura de websites modernos. Por meio do balanceamento de carga global e do cache em borda, ela resolve de forma eficaz problemas como latência de rede, gargalos de largura de banda e alta concorrência, proporcionando uma experiência de acesso extremamente rápida para os usuários. Ao mesmo tempo, reduz os custos para os proprietários de websites, aprimora a segurança e aumenta a confiabilidade dos serviços. Desde a escolha do fornecedor adequado até a implementação de estratégias detalhadas de cache e segurança, compreender e utilizar plenamente todas as funcionalidades do CDN é um passo crucial para construir serviços digitais rápidos, robustos e globalizados no atual ambiente competitivo da internet.

Perguntas frequentes Perguntas frequentes

O CDN (Content Delivery Network) acelera o conteúdo de sites dinâmicos?

Tradicionalmente, os CDNs (Content Delivery Networks) se concentravam principalmente em acelerar o conteúdo estático que pode ser armazenado em cache. No entanto, os serviços CDN modernos também conseguem acelerar significativamente o conteúdo dinâmico através de tecnologias como roteamento inteligente, otimização de conexões TCP e computação em borda. Por exemplo, eles podem escolher o caminho de origem com as melhores condições de rede e menor latência para solicitações dinâmicas, melhorando assim a velocidade de resposta dos APIs e o tempo de carregamento de páginas personalizadas.

A utilização de uma CDN afeta o ranking de SEO do site?

O uso correto de um CDN (Content Delivery Network) não só não prejudica o SEO, como também o melhora significativamente. Os mecanismos de busca, como o Google, consideram a velocidade do site como um fator importante para a classificação dos resultados. O CDN melhora a experiência do usuário ao aumentar a velocidade de acesso e a disponibilidade do site em todo o mundo, o que, por sua vez, é benéfico para o SEO. Além disso, a maioria dos serviços de CDN consegue lidar bem com as visitas dos robôs de busca, garantindo que o conteúdo seja indexado corretamente.

Qual é a diferença entre um CDN (Content Delivery Network) e serviços de armazenamento em nuvem (como o armazenamento de objetos)?

Estes são dois serviços com objetivos diferentes. A função principal do CDN (Content Delivery Network) é “acelerar” e “distribuir” o conteúdo; geralmente, ele não armazena dados de forma permanente, mas atua como um camada de cache para o site fonte (que pode ser armazenamento em nuvem, um servidor, etc.). Já o serviço de armazenamento em nuvem (como o armazenamento de objetos) tem como função principal o armazenamento “permanente” de grandes volumes de dados, oferecendo alta confiabilidade e escalabilidade. Na prática, os dois serviços são frequentemente utilizados em conjunto: os arquivos estáticos são armazenados em buckets de armazenamento de objetos e utilizados como fonte para o CDN, garantindo assim um armazenamento seguro e acesso rápido ao conteúdo.

Como determinar se o meu site já foi integrado com sucesso à CDN?

Existem vários métodos simples de verificação. Primeiramente, você pode usar ferramentas de teste de velocidade de sites (como Pingdom, GTmetrix) para verificar os detalhes do carregamento dos recursos. Se imagens, arquivos CSS e outros arquivos estáticos estiverem sendo carregados a partir do domínio do fornecedor de CDN, e não do seu próprio domínio de origem, isso indica que a integração foi bem-sucedida. Em segundo lugar, você pode usar comandos na linha de comando para realizar mais verificações. nslookup ou dig O comando verifica o domínio principal do seu site. Se o endereço IP retornado for o IP de um node do provedor de CDN, e não o IP do seu servidor, isso também indica que a resolução DNS está funcionando corretamente. Por fim, verifique a aba “Rede” (Network) das ferramentas de desenvolvimento do navegador para verificar se os cabeçalhos da resposta contêm informações específicas do provedor de CDN (como…). Server, X-Cache (etc.).